Feb 18, 2013

Picture of the Day

Throwing out the ceremonial first ball at tonight's IFL
 flag football championship at Kraft Stadium in Jerusalem.

1 comment:

  1. With apologies to the Skins:

    Hail to MK Lipman
    Hail victory
    NeoHareidi on the warpath
    Better com join the army...


